[nysbirds-l] BROWN PELICAN at Robert Moses SP (Suffolk County)
Pat Lindsay, Pete Morris and I just had a BROWN PELICAN fly past the concession building at parking field 2 at Robert Moses. It was well out over the ocean and high, heading east to west. When last seen it was dropping a bit and angling toward shore somewhere between Fire Island to Cedar Beach. If birding along the south shore today it might pay to keep your eyes open for it.
